How to Get to Burleigh Heads

Plane

When flying to Burleigh Heads, you’ll arrive at Coolangatta Gold Coast (OOL), which is located 6 miles from the city centre. Airlines that fly from New Zealand to Burleigh Heads include Jetstar, Qantas Airways and Air New Zealand. The shortest flight to Burleigh Heads from New Zealand departs from Wellington and takes around 3h 35m.

Car

Another option to get to Burleigh Heads is to pick up a car hire from Brisbane, which is about 51 miles from Burleigh Heads. You’ll find branches of Alpha and EverythingFleet, among others, in Brisbane.

Hiring a car in Burleigh Heads

Expect to pay $1.87 per litre in Burleigh Heads (average price from the past 30 days). Depending on the size of your car hire, filling up the tank will cost between $22.38 and $29.84. Compact (Subaru Crosstrek or similar) is the most popular car type to hire in Burleigh Heads, while also 46% cheaper than other types, on average.
